Heading is looking for his client , a DWDM Engineer (M/F) for Maputo


Activities:

  • Transmission expert with good understanding of multiple DWDM platform.
  • Will be responsible for management, maintaining, and troubleshooting the high-capacity optical fiber backbone.
  • Be able to serve as the critical 2nd or 3rd-line tier of support, ensuring seamless, high-speed data transmission across the network.
  • General understanding of the process and principles of automatic IPRAN and PTN.
  • Be skillful in using network management systems (NMS) and other tools to analyze optical alarms—such as signal degradation, excessive Bit Error Rate (BER), fiber cuts, or amplifier failures.
  • Daily network check.
  • Service provisioning on new services.
  • Manage DWDM low level configurations operational support.
  • Change management and support operations, such as migration, and expansion.
  • Routine maintenance task, such as license check and distribution.
  • Designing, configuring, and testing new optical wavelengths or circuits as requested by enterprise and wholesale clients.
  • Good command of the LLD of NCE Manager+Controller+Analyzer in the on premises.
  • Project support (Add On Sales.)
  • Handling accidents: Participate in NCE accident handling, cooperate in quick accident recovery, and participate in fault locating.
  • Good understanding & Configuration and Troubleshooting skills on transmission protection mechanisms, like SNCP, MSP, ASON.etc.
  • Reporting network status to key stakeholders and ability to take informed decisions.
  • Provide L1/L2 support to FO and field resource.
  • Isolate and Identifies POF for hub sites and advise Field resource on what to check on site.
  • General understanding of the principles and processes of managing NEs, monitoring alarms, managing performances.
  • Routine network analysis including redundancy checks.
  • Manage DWDM configurations and L2 Operations support.
  • General resolution of Packet loss and IUB frame loss.
  • Investigation and resolution of O&M fault and SCTP fault.
  • General understanding of the classification of transport equipment. Sound familiar with NE Explorer for SDH, WDM, and OTN equipment.

Requirements:

  • Degree in Computer Science, Electrical Engineering or Telecommunications Engineering.
  • 3-5 years of experience.
  •  Keeping track of all hardware versions and software versions in domain follow up with all team members to complete all tasks in time.
  • Should have in-depth knowledge of equipment, hardware, software features and limitations of the nodes in domain.
  • Ability to prepare solutions based on health check before major network incidents happen.
  • Work with cross domain teams to identify bottle necks in network and prepare solutions.
